CCM12130 - Opening and Working Enquiries: Opening an enquiry
You
must always open your enquiry by
- sending the notice of enquiry to the claimant. If the claim was made by a couple, you must send a notice to each member of the couple, and
- enclosing a copy of the WTC/FS1 on NTC Enquiries.
You should use the standard letter template, TCC1 at
CCM21400 in every case.
You should always ask informally for the information you
need, at every stage of the enquiry, before considering the use of
formal information powers. A formal notice should not be issued
unless the claimant has refused to co-operate with an informal
request for information, or has failed to produce some or all of
that information within the specified time. You can find guidance
on the use of the formal information power at S19(2) at
CCM12200-
CCM12275.
